About this school

Keshena Primary is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Keshena, Menominee County. The school has 429 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Menominee Indian School District school district. It serves grades Pre-Kโ€“5 in a rural setting. The school employs 51 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 8.4:1. Technology infrastructure includes fiber internet, campus-wide Wi-Fi, devices for students.

Student demographics

By race and ethnicity, the student body is 86% American Indian or Alaska Native, 7.2% Hispanic or Latino and 6.1% Two or more races.

Free & reduced-price lunch

398 of the school's 429 students (93%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 376 qualify for free lunch and 22 for a reduced price.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.

School setting & status

Rural, DistantGrades Pre-Kโ€“5Title I

Keshena Primary is located in a rural setting (NCES locale: Rural, Distant).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families. School district: Menominee Indian School District

Keshena Primary is one of 4 schools in Menominee Indian School District, based in Keshena, Wisconsin. The district serves 994 students district-wide and employs 96 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 429 students, Keshena Primary is larger than the district average of about 249 students per school.
